Chapter 546: Demon Beast

Unlike the Cultivators from the three Sects who were stationed in Jiran Valley year-round, this joint operation was a short-term mission.

The next day, Song Yan and the others followed Lu Ziye, clearing the area around the Spirit Valley.

"This kind of spiritual energy fluctuation, which also affects the spiritual plants and Spirit Beasts in the valley, is most likely due to a few situations."

Gu Qingqing curiously stared at this "Senior Brother Lu"; he didn’t seem as strange as Senior Sister Liu Yuechan had said.

Lu Ziye led the three towards the Spirit Demon Plain, explaining, "First, there are special Spirit Beasts appearing. In the Cultivation World, there are many Spirit Beasts and Demon Beasts that are accompanied by special spiritual energy fluctuations, and this is the most probable situation."

"Second, there is a Cultivator at the Foundation Establishment Great Perfection Realm nearby who is attempting to Breakthrough to the Golden Core Realm... but this possibility is extremely low."

It made sense; in a small place like Chu, most Sect Disciples would choose to Breakthrough within their own Sect’s mountain gate for safety.

Those who usually chose to Breakthrough in these mountain wilds were typically Loose Cultivators.

As for the situation of Loose Cultivators in Chu, the Six Major Sects generally knew their backgrounds thoroughly. If there truly was a Loose Cultivator with the potential to Breakthrough to Golden Core, it would have been widely known, and people would have already sought to befriend them.

"The third possibility is that a Secret Realm or grotto-heaven is about to appear near the Spirit Valley, and its spatial fluctuations are affecting the valley’s ecosystem..."

"This possibility is the lowest."

"For missions like this, it’s usually just some Demon Beast causing trouble. Most of you are doing your first Sect mission, so there’s no need to be too nervous."

Lu Ziye said sternly, "You don’t need to exert yourselves, and there won’t be any danger."

But in his heart, he sighed deeply.

When other Sects had joint missions, Inner Sect Disciples always went in pairs. Why was he the only one this time?

With no familiar faces to tease, it was truly boring.

If he had to pick someone familiar, it was that Outer Sect Disciple named Song Yan.

What did his Master see in him, waiting at that dilapidated little shop every day for this kid to show up?

"Could it be that she’s trying to eat tender grass from an old cow..."

With no one to chat with and be mischievous, he resorted to sacrilegious, malicious speculation about Qin Xijun in his heart, almost failing to suppress a laugh.

Leaving Jiran Valley, two thousand-year-old green wutong trees intertwined to form a natural gate, their gnarled roots submerged in a cold spring, with faded Talismans of prayer floating on the water’s surface.

"Peace year after year..."

"Diligently cultivate without ceasing..."

These prayer Talismans should have originally been hung on the branches by the Disciples stationed here year-round, but they had fallen due to wind and sun.

Lu Ziye’s tone was relaxed: "Since there’s nothing to do, I’ll take you to Spirit Demon Plain first..."

He thought that these newly promoted Outer Sect Disciples probably hadn’t participated in many outdoor missions.

Many outdoor missions were indeed full of danger, but tasks like clearing the Spirit Valley were truly like sightseeing.

"I’ll take these kids out to play for a couple of days, and they’ll understand..."

Chatting and walking, the stone path turned and opened up abruptly at a broken cliff.

The strong winds of Spirit Demon Plain, mixed with the fresh scent of grass and trees, assailed them. Song Yan clutched his robes, which were being lifted by the airflow.

Deer of various colors leaped, treading the morning glow, their long tails spreading a faint spiritual charm. A Xuan-patterned tiger lay in a doze on a boulder, its breath stirring. There were also some Demon Beasts that Song Yan had never even seen in books or ancient texts, whose names he couldn’t recall.

"What a magnificent sight..."

A few young Cultivators, who hadn’t seen much of the world, marveled at the magnificent scenery of Spirit Demon Plain as they walked across the plain.

Occasionally, Cultivators familiar to Lu Ziye would greet him; they seemed to be Disciples from other Sects.

"Buzz—"

A sound transmission Talisman flew from afar and landed beside Lu Ziye.

"Brother Lu, outside Jiran Valley, near Hidden Moon Lake to the east, a First-Stage Late Stage Demon Beast has been detected. Come quickly to assist..."

A Demon Beast?

Lu Ziye’s expression changed... but after a moment’s thought, he smiled with relief: "It seems the mission will end very soon. No more fun for us..."

A First-Stage Late Stage Demon Beast, solely based on its demonic power level, was equivalent to a human Cultivator at the Qi Refining Late Stage Realm.

However, Demon Beasts were naturally physically formidable, and a few even possessed strange Divine Abilities. Therefore, a Demon Beast of the same Realm would require two or three human Cultivators to attack it together to contend with it.

Fortunately, with the Disciples of the three Sects gathered, it wasn’t a problem.

But Lu Ziye wondered, "Could just one First-Stage Late Stage Demon Beast cause such a widespread spiritual energy fluctuation?"

"Could it be on the verge of advancing to Second Stage..." 𝕗𝚛𝚎𝚎𝐰𝗲𝗯𝗻𝚘𝚟𝚎𝗹.𝕔𝐨𝕞

By the time Lu Ziye arrived near Hidden Moon Lake with the Cave Abyss Sect Disciples, the Disciples from the other two Sects were already standing on the nearby cliff.

"Brother Lu."

Song Yan stood almost at the back of the crowd, everyone looking towards the distant cold pond.

Beneath the calm water of the pond, a faint white light flickered, like breathing spiritual light.

"Crucian Carp Dragon..."

Beside Song Yan, another Cultivator from a different Sect, also standing at the back of the crowd, looked slightly puzzled and said:

"This fish demon dislikes cold ponds, so why would it appear in Hidden Moon Lake..."

This person was dressed in a white Daoist robe; judging by the insignia patterns on the cuffs and collar, he seemed to be a Disciple of the Spirit Talisman Sect.

He seemed to have a hidden meaning in his words, but Song Yan didn’t pick up on anything.

"Senior Brother seems very familiar with this demon?"

"I am Wan Songran, of the Wan Family from Chen Prefecture."

The Wan Family... Song Yan suddenly understood.

In the land of Chu, besides the Six Major Sects, there were also four great Cultivation Families.

The Zhao Family of Eastern Chu.

The Qin Family of Southern Chu.

The Wan Family of Western Chu.

The Yan Family of Northern Chu.

Although the strength of the four great aristocratic families couldn’t compare to the Six Major Sects, they were still comparable to Sects like Ziyang Sect.

Among them, the Wan Family from Chen Prefecture in Western Chu was famous throughout the land for its Spirit-controlling methods, so it was natural for them to be familiar with these Demon Beasts.

A descendant of a prestigious Family... "Brother Wang, Brother Chai, is this fish demon the culprit behind the spiritual valley’s fluctuations this time?"

Lu Ziye’s expression was suspicious. After a spiritual examination, judging from its aura, this fish demon was still far from advancing to Second Stage.

"Heh heh, whether it’s the culprit or not, no one knows right now. Slaying this demon first and returning to report is the proper course of action."

"Xia Wei, set up the formation."

"Yes, Senior Brother."

Three Outer Sect Disciples from Profound Origin Sect flew forward, and in a short while, they had already placed Formation Plates and formation beads at three corners of Hidden Moon Lake, beginning to set up the formation.

As if sensing a threat, the previously calm cold pond began to subtly stir.

Bang!

A large, dark Crucian Carp Dragon leaped out of the pond, roaring with an open mouth, bringing forth gusts of demonic wind.

At the same time, in the shallow water by the pond, more than ten small demons emerged in single file, mostly First-Stage Early Stage, with a few First-Stage Middle Stage Demon Beasts among them.

"Cave Abyss Sect Disciples, assist in slaying the surrounding small demons."

After giving instructions, Lu Ziye, along with Wang Xi and Chai Yanghui, an Inner Sect Disciple of the Spirit Talisman Sect, went forward to confront the fish demon.

The fish demon flicked its long tail, attempting to knock away the three Disciples setting up the formation, but it was blocked by a stream of azure jade light.

Chai Yanghui moved the Talisman in his hand, and the azure jade glow began to spread, forming a circular net, attempting to trap the fish demon within it.

"What a powerful Talisman..."

Song Yan exclaimed. This was the Spirit Talisman Sect of Xiapi Prefecture in Lin Prefecture, renowned for its Talismans!

One Talisman unleashed could trap a First-Stage Late Stage Demon Beast!

He didn’t get lost in admiring the extraordinary talent of the three great Sect’s Inner Sect Disciples; the sounds of Spiritual Artifacts and Spells surged around him like a tide.

Song Yan’s mind was steady, and he summoned his Flying Sword, joining the battlefield.

The small demons in the pond were all water-element Demon Beasts, so his slightly more proficient fire-element Spell had little effect.

And among the Cultivators present, his cultivation was considered to be at the bottom, with no offensive pressure, which was actually perfect for practicing the few Flying Sword manipulation techniques recorded in the "Essentials of Swordsmanship."

At the same time, in a corner of the battlefield no one was paying attention to.

Wan Songran, the Spirit Talisman Sect Disciple who had spoken to Song Yan earlier, retreated while fighting, gradually disappearing into the deep forest by the pond.

With a few leaps, he jumped onto a branch, and using the dense foliage, he watched the fierce battle in the pond from afar, his gaze fixed on Wang Xi.

"With Wang Xi’s strength, plus five Profound Origin Sect Disciples, this battle should end very quickly..."

"But he’s not using Spiritual Artifacts, not employing killing moves, not activating spiritual energy..."

"Right now, it’s completely the Cave Abyss Sect’s Inner Sect Disciple and Senior Brother Chai Yanghui leading the charge."

"This Wang Xi."

"No, it should be said that this Profound Origin Sect has a big problem."

His gaze shifted between Wang Xi and Shen Huai, finally narrowing as he took out a red and black short flute from his qiankun bag.
